连续需求下整合关税成本的选址-库存模型

Keywords: 运输经济,选址-库存模型,粒子群优化算法,国际物流网络,关税成本

Abstract:

针对国际物流网络设计中忽视连续需求下库存成本影响问题,基于梯级库存持有成本和产品的价值增值过程,建立了连续需求下包含关税成本的多层级选址-库存模型。模型考虑了设施打开成本、运输成本、库存成本、采购成本、生产成本和关税成本之间的相互影响关系,同时对网络结构参数、运输量和订货批量进行决策。利用粒子群优化算法对多个不同的算例进行了求解。算例结果表明在国际物流网络设计中,考虑关税影响能够带来明显的成本节约,而且随着需求、单位运输成本和库存成本的增加,这种节约会增大;建立的模型和设计的粒子群优化算法是有效和可行的,可以用于国际物流网络设计。
